semantic

Semantic search and hygiene checks over a directory of markdown and source code — eighteen languages — as a single local Go binary. It embeds your content with a local ONNX model and cosine-ranks queries against a local SQLite index. No API key, no network, fully offline.

Point it at an Obsidian vault, a docs/ tree, an engineering-notes folder, or a codebase, and find things by meaning rather than exact keyword — then keep the corpus healthy: consolidate duplicates, fix dead links, and connect orphaned notes.

Why

Grep finds the word you typed. It doesn't find the note you wrote six months ago that says the same thing in different words, and it can't tell you which two docs are 90% redundant or which links rot. semantic runs a real embedding model on your machine to answer both kinds of question — retrieval and corpus hygiene — without shipping your notes to anyone.

  • Local & offline. all-MiniLM-L6-v2 (384-dim) runs via onnxruntime; the model + runtime download once (~120MB) and never phone home.
  • Fast & incremental. Content is chunked, embedded, and stored in SQLite; reindexing only re-embeds files whose content hash changed.
  • Safe to upgrade. The index records which chunker, link extractor, and embedding model built it. When a new release changes any of them, it rebuilds the affected rows automatically and tells you why — no stale results, and no --force you had to know to run.
  • Markdown- and code-aware. Markdown is chunked by its heading tree; source by its syntax tree, one chunk per symbol carrying the doc comment and the signature — implementation bodies aren't embedded. Eighteen languages, listed below.

Languages

Every language is parsed with tree-sitter. The retrieval surface is a symbol's documentation and signature, never its body: a body is implementation, and embedding it dilutes what the symbol is for.

Two of those needed a judgment call rather than a translation:

  • YAML has no declarations, only nesting. Chunking every key floods the index; chunking whole files averages a Deployment, a Service, and a ConfigMap into one meaningless vector. The unit is the document plus its top-level keys, and a document that declares kind and metadata.name is identified by them — so it retrieves as Deployment/api-gateway, not "the third document".
  • Bash is mostly top-level commands. Only functions, documented variables, and the script's own header comment are indexed; the rest would bury them.

Filtering by language

--lang narrows a search to one or more languages. It is repeatable or comma-separated, and accepts the names people actually type (c++, k8s, terraform, py). semantic langs prints the full list.

semantic search "session state transitions" --lang go
semantic search "how replicas are set" --lang yaml,hcl
semantic search "retry logic" --lang python --lang go

A misspelled language is an error, not an empty result — a search returning nothing should mean "no such code", never "no such flag value".

Install

mise use -g "go:github.com/reactor-team/semantic/cmd/semantic@latest"
semantic init             # one-time: fetch the embedding model + ONNX runtime

One prerequisite: a C compiler. The ONNX runtime is linked via cgo, so CGO_ENABLED=1 is required. The SQLite side is pure Go. macOS: xcode-select --install. Debian: apt install build-essential.

To build from a clone instead, use mise run install, which puts the binary in $(go env GOPATH)/bin with its version stamped in.

Corpus hygiene, in a bit more detail
  • dupes does an all-pairs cosine scan over content-bearing chunks (markdown sections and source doc-comments) to surface redundancy, cross-file by default.
  • graph resolves [text](path) and [[wikilink]] edges at query time, so renames fix links without rewriting sources. It reports orphans (no inbound link), broken links (target resolves to nothing), and broken anchors (the file resolves but the #section matches no heading) — so linking straight to a section is safe and validated. --backlinks PATH shows what points at a file; --json/--dot feed other tooling.
  • lint catches three link smells and one structure smell. First, doc or source-code references written as inline code (`docs/x.md`, `pkg/file.go`), which never become graph edges (so a file referenced only that way reads as an orphan): split into unlinked (resolve to exactly one file — worth turning into a link), ambiguous (a bare basename with no directory, like `service.go`, matches more than one indexed file of that name — promoting it would silently pick whichever sorts first, so it's reported with its full candidate list instead), and broken (dead path or dead #section). Second, deep relative links — real [text](path) links that climb two or more directories with ../../; it suggests the equivalent root-absolute path (/docs/x.md), which survives moving the source file. The suggestion is anchored at the enclosing git repository root the way GitHub resolves a leading-/ link, so a vault indexed below the repo root (a monorepo or docs/ sub-tree) gets the right prefix (/subproj/docs/x.md); with no repo it stays vault-relative. Third, missing Contents TOCs — markdown files over 100 lines whose committed ## Contents table is absent or out of date, so a partial read of a long file still reveals its full scope. --fix rewrites the auto-fixable findings in place: unlinked inline-code refs become real links (`pkg/file.go`[`pkg/file.go`](/pkg/file.go), the original path as label, root-absolute so it resolves from wherever it's written), deep links to their root-absolute form, and Contents TOCs regenerated from the heading tree (a plain-text outline directly under the ## Contents heading); ambiguous and broken refs still need a human. False positives suppress ESLint-style with <!-- semantic-ignore --> on the offending line, -next-line on the line above, or -file at the top to exempt a whole file — the shape a vendored or verbatim third-party document wants, since it silences the TOC check too. --unlinked/--ambiguous/--broken/--deep/ --toc narrow both the report and --fix to just the selected kinds (--unlinked --fix promotes unlinked refs only, touching neither deep links nor TOCs). Passing file paths (semantic lint --toc --fix <files…>) scopes every check and fix to just those files — the shape a pre-commit hook wants so it touches only staged files, not the whole vault.

Configuration

Env var Meaning
SEMANTIC_DB Override the index database path (also --db).
SEMANTIC_CACHE_DIR / SEMANTIC_MODEL_DIR Where the model/runtime are cached.
SEMANTIC_ORT_LIB Path to a specific ONNX runtime shared library.

search, dupes, graph, and lint incrementally reindex the vault before answering (a stat-only no-op when nothing changed), so they never silently read a stale index. Pass --no-reindex to skip this and read the index exactly as it was after the last explicit semantic index.
